2NE1 VS Girls' Generation - All Out War?

The beacon has been lit, the gong rung and we can hear the war cries in the cold eerie distance. When the announcement came that two of Korea's biggest girl groups were both making a comeback fans rejoiced, SONEs had been eagerly waiting for announcement of a comeback since early January whilst 2NE1's severely delayed comeback was met with rejoice from Blackjacks.

However the announcement that both groups would make their comeback with about a week in between them soon turned the celebration sour as both Blackjacks and SONEs predicted who would win this comeback war. YG added more fuel to the fire retweeting an article which declared an all-out girl group war. This feud between Blackjacks and SONEs has now reached a point where music is not the focus but just simply a war of insults. 

After watching this mess take place it brings about the question, why does it matter? Why can we not have more than one girl group on top. Both these groups have had immense worldwide popularity and success and no matter what anyone says no one can take that away.

Girls' Generation's title track "Mr. Mr.", which was produced by The Underdogs (Beyonce, Chris Brown, Jordin Sparks) will debut on the 19th whilst the mini-album will follow on the 24th. 2NE1's title track will have a reportedly 500 Million KRW ($496,000) production music video which will be released on the 28th with a teaser released on the 24th with the album CRUSH following soon after.

We will all be eagerly waiting to see who will win this was and at what cost. One thing is for sure both groups have worked extremely hard and are immensely talented.
